问题标签 [public-html]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
2425 浏览

ftp - 如何通过 FileZilla 访问 public_html?

我们的网站使用 CPanel 托管。当我们通过 FileZilla 通过 sftp 连接时,由于某种原因,我们无法访问public_html. 它适用于Mac上的FileZilla,但在PC上,如果我们在同一个目录中键入,它会自动添加一个反斜杠,所以它变成了public_html\,这对于显示站点不起作用。

你会建议在public_html没有反斜杠的情况下连接什么?

0 投票
2 回答
2421 浏览

php - public_html 之外的提要文件

我无法从“public_html”外部向用户上传文件,这是每个人都可以通过 http 访问的文件夹。前任。/ 之后的 www.website.com/everyhting 是 public_html。相信大家都知道我指的是什么。

所以我有这个脚本应该从(服务器视角)/images/protected/读取文件(sample.pdf),但PHP找不到我的文件。我做错了吗?

每次执行此脚本时,我都会404 - FILE NOT FOUND!<br />\n下载文件而不是文件。

0 投票
2 回答
2099 浏览

apache - 更改 public_html 文件夹的名称

我有两个用于特定网站的文件夹。有一个主要的 www.mysite.com 站点,它位于 home/user/public_html,然后我有一个子域 -> dev.mysite.com 用于该站点的最新开发版本,位于 /home/user/dev_html

可能是因为以前把新站点移动到主目录的懒惰,我刚刚备份了当前站点,通过ftp下载,擦除站点文件,然后上传新站点。然而,ftp 是如此缓慢且不可靠,以至于这是一种非常缓慢且容易出错的方式——尤其是对于大型站点。

所以我想只通过 ssh 登录,然后将所有文件移出 public_html,然后从 dev_html 复制新文件,但后来我震惊了。我不能将 public_html 文件夹的名称更改为 public_html_old 之类的名称,然后将 dev_html 更改为 public_html 吗?如果我这样做,Apache 会发疯吗?

如果这是一个愚蠢的问题,请原谅我。

0 投票
1 回答
1964 浏览

apache - apache 无法访问 CIFS 上的 public_html

我的计算机在网络上,并且整个 homedir 都在使用 CIFS 登录时安装。当我访问http://localhost时,一切正常,但是当我访问http://localhost/~user时,它失败了。

浏览器说:

阿帕奇说

任何想法?

0 投票
0 回答
378 浏览

.htaccess - Web 服务器上的目录结构

我已经获得了一个域http://www.public.xxx.xxx/~user/和一个基于 Web 的 GUI,可以将文件上传到我的网站。我创建了一些我想用密码保护的目录。我在指定 htpasswd 文件的绝对路径时遇到了困难,因为我不知道目录结构。到目前为止,我已经尝试了以下路径。

还有什么我可以尝试的吗?

PS:我不知道服务器上运行的操作系统。

您的建议将非常有帮助!

谢谢

0 投票
2 回答
6804 浏览

php - 如何使用 PHP 定位公用文件夹?

我正在用 PHP 编写安装脚本,我的应用程序的一部分可能安装在公用文件夹上一层的文件夹中。通常,公用文件夹称为“public_html”,但并非总是如此。有没有一些简单的方法可以使用 PHP 找到根公用文件夹的名称或路径?

0 投票
1 回答
187 浏览

mod-rewrite - 如何使用 mod_rewrite 模拟公共目录

我将我的网站文件保存在/public/目录中。

因此,例如,要访问 css 文件,如果我们指向绝对 html 路径,它将是

/public/css/reset.css.

我有/public/index.php处理每个请求的文件。所以,我的主站点 API 工作正常。

这是我的简单 .htaccess :(在public目录之外)

如何添加 mod_rewrite 规则,所以,当我问mysite.com/css/reset.css我得到mysite.com/public/css/reset.css(所以,对于其他文件)

0 投票
3 回答
234 浏览

git - 公共 git 存储库

是否可以在 ssh 服务器上公开 git 存储库?我在 ssh 服务器上有一个帐户,想用它来存储项目的 git 存储库。我们与项目中的 2 人一起工作,但我无法向其他成员提供我的帐户密码......我如何确保我的团队成员可以在不知道我的密码的情况下从存储库中推送和拉取?

0 投票
3 回答
633 浏览

php - 保护 public_html 中的文件夹

我有一个音乐共享网站,并意识到我网站上的文件不一定受到保护,因为它们存储在 public_html 的子文件夹中。我需要保护它们,使它们仍然适用于音乐播放器中的任何人,该播放器位于 listen.php 页面上。但是,如果用户直接转到一个文件,例如这个http://www.pearlsquirrel.com/mp3/95d246c26a7c003cdac86ead05659b37.m4a。我不希望他们能够下载文件以保护我的用户。但是,我无法向该页面添加任何代码,因为它是 mp3。有没有办法将索引添加到允许我向该页面添加 javascript 的文件夹?我尝试使用 .htaccess 但没有运气。如果有人知道我如何解决这个问题,将不胜感激。谢谢!

0 投票
1 回答
204 浏览

cakephp-2.0 - 使用 CakePhp 2.0 访问 public_html 中的子目录

我的问题很简单。

我的 /public_html 目录上有一个 /cms 子目录。

当我尝试这样做时:mysite.com/cms cake 尝试查找 cms 控制器,而不是显示 /cms 包含的 index.php。

如何制作蛋糕以在 public_html 中搜索此文件夹?

谢谢。